What is a computer science sports?

A Computer Science Sports job involves using technology, data analysis, and software development to improve various aspects of sports. Professionals in this field may work on performance analytics, sports simulations, wearable technology, or data-driven decision-making for teams and athletes. They often use programming, machine learning, and statistical analysis to optimize player performance, injury prevention, and game strategies. This role can be found in sports organizations, tech companies, and research institutions.

What does a computer science sports do?

Individuals working in Computer Science Sports typically spend their days collecting and analyzing performance data, developing software tools or predictive models to support coaching decisions, and collaborating with multidisciplinary teams including coaches, trainers, and sports scientists. They may also be responsible for maintaining databases, visualizing data for reports, and ensuring data integrity across multiple sources. Regular meetings with stakeholders help ensure projects align with team goals and athletic objectives. This role offers a dynamic environment at the intersection of technology and sports, with the potential to directly impact athletic performance and strategy.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in computer science sports?

To succeed in a Computer Science Sports role, you should have a strong background in computer science fundamentals such as programming, data structures, and analytics, often paired with knowledge of sports science or management. Experience with data analytics tools, sport-specific software platforms, and programming languages like Python or R is highly valued, and certifications in areas such as data science or sports analytics can be advantageous. Excellent problem-solving, teamwork, and communication skills help in translating complex data insights to coaches, athletes, or executives. These abilities are important because they bridge the gap between technology and sports performance, driving informed decision-making and innovation in the athletic industry.

How is computer science used in sports?

Computer science in sports involves developing data analysis tools, performance tracking systems, and simulation models to improve athlete training and game strategies. Professionals in this field often work with programming languages, data visualization, and machine learning to enhance sports performance and fan engagement.

Junior Data Scientist- Philadelphia, Data Science - Sports + Entertainment

Aramark Sports + Entertainment is hiring a Junior Data Scientist based in Philadelphia to support our Sports + Entertainment portfolio, including the Philadelphia Phillies, Philadelphia Eagles, Philadelphia Union, and other regional venues, to support data analysis of food and beverage trends. This position will focus on data governance, advanced analysis and modeling, and data-backed recommendations to maximize opportunity.

Please note this is an onsite position in Philadelphia and is not remote.  

About Data Science Group 
The Data Science division is the epicenter of data analytics, uncovering impactful insights that put Aramark clients in the sports and entertainment industry ahead of the curve. Using leading-edge technology and analytics, Data Science synthesizes operational and consumer data to optimize strategies that enhance the guest hospitality experience and blaze a trail for innovation.  Through continuous expansion of analytical capabilities and a comprehensive method of understanding the industry at large, Data Science harnesses the power of data as the most strategic asset in maximizing value for consumers, operators, and businesses alike.

Job Responsibilities

   Analyze consumer behavior across Philadelphia venues by leveraging purchasing and dining data to identify key customer segments. Present insights using statistical methods and engaging visualizations tailored to diverse stakeholder audiences.
   Evaluate operational performance by integrating data from labor tracking, Point of Sale (POS), and inventory systems. Identify inefficiencies and recommend actionable improvements to enhance venue operations. 
   Conduct ad-hoc analyses to assess the effectiveness of short-term strategies.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define success metrics and deliver timely, data-backed evaluations.
   Support the development of automated reporting workflows that deliver key performance metrics to stakeholders across Philadelphia-area venues, including Citizens Bank Park, Lincoln Financial Field, Subaru Park, and more.
   Assist in building scalable data pipelines using Python, R, and SQL to streamline data access and support analytics and reporting initiatives.
   Assist in the development of AI-powered applications and agentic workflows that automate operational tasks, orchestrate business processes, and deliver actionable recommendations to end users.
   Perform machine learning experiments and model evaluation tasks under the guidance of the team's Senior Manager of Data Science.
